Fowler’s Lion Ruler Of Fowler’s Live & The Jam Factory
If you were to walk or drive down North Terrace in Adelaide you couldn’t help but notice the old Fowler’s Lion Factory. The feature that makes it stand out from the rest of the buildings on the street is the majestic stone statue of the lion on top of the building. The appearance of the lion is definitely one of royalty as he stands there watching over his subjects as they move past his watchful gaze.
David and James Fowler, the men who first established D and J Fowler (Australia) Ltd in 1854, moved their retail outlet from King William St. to this building in 1906. It seems that destiny had other plans for this building, other than the owners original plans for it.

In the 70′s up until 1998 it was the home of The Adelaide Fringe Festival. At present it houses the nightclub Fowler’s Live, the Jam Factory which is art related and has nothing to do with jam at all, as well as other venues.
